CDV has updated the official Grom website with seven new screenshots of this action adventure game developed by Rebelmind. The game is planned for 2nd half 2002.
It's hard to believe what is happening in 1942: Far from the chaos of war, Tibet suddenly becomes the hottest spot in the race for world domination. For here, one of the führer's special units is searching feverishly for the Lost City of King Arjuna. According to legend, the king concealed twelve miracle weapons there. Each one by itself is capable of erasing major cities in the blink of an eye. One shudders to think what might happen if the Nazis got hold of even one of them. Features: Action adventure / RPG Stunning graphics: extraordinary combination of 2D landscapes and 3D characters More than 40 interesting characters Play up to 3 characters at once Movie-style 3D sound effects, even in the unique cut scenes 7 intriguing chapters with almost 100 locations Over a dozen different weapons, from blunderbuss to machine gun More than 30 usable objects Dynamic real-time combat with many strategic actions Varied story line with fantastic elements set against a realistic background Eliminate demons, monsters and wizards inspired by Tibetan mythology User-friendly interface and simple, logical game play
